Lost Key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ide
Losing keys can be an aggravating experience, whether it’s an automobile key, a house key, or an office key. In today’s busy world, the hassle of changing keys can cause unwanted stress, potential security problems, and unforeseen costs. Comprehending the procedure of lost key replacement can conserve time, cash, and frustration. This post will supply valuable insights into numerous methods of changing lost keys, the significance of key management, and preventative procedures.
Understanding the Different Types of Keys
Before diving into the key replacement process, it’s crucial to understand the various kinds of keys that a person might lose:
Type of KeyDescriptionHome KeysBasic or electronic keys utilized for homes.Car KeysConsists of traditional keys, remote keys, and smart keys.Office KeysKeys that secure workplace equipment or sensitive areas.PadlocksKeys for outdoor or indoor padlocks.Safe KeysSpecific keys utilized for vaults or safes, frequently difficult to change.Transponder KeysSpecialized car keys that communicate with the vehicle.Steps to Replace Lost Keys
The treatment for replacing keys varies substantially based upon the kind of key and its modus operandi. Below are the steps generally included in replacing lost keys.
Step 1: Assess the Type of KeyIdentify the key type: Understanding whether you have a basic key, a remote key, or a smart key will direct your replacement choices.Inspect for duplicates: Look for any spare keys that may be available before continuing.Action 2: Contact a ProfessionalPertinent locksmith: For house and workplace keys, get in touch with a locksmith who concentrates on your type of lock.Car dealer: For car keys, it is suggested to visit your local car dealership or an automotive locksmith.Action 3: Gather Necessary Information
Before contacting an expert, prepare important information:
Identification: Be ready to provide evidence of ownership, such as an ID or vehicle registration.Key information: Describe the lost key, including its type, make, and model.Step 4: Get Quotes and Choose a SolutionCost Estimation: Key replacement expenses can differ extensively depending upon the kind of key. Here are some typical estimates.Key TypeEstimated Replacement CostHome Key₤ 1 - ₤ 5Car Locksmith Services Key (conventional)₤ 5 - ₤ 100Car Key (remote/smart)₤ 150 - ₤ 500Workplace Key₤ 5 - ₤ 50Padlock Key₤ 5 - ₤ 30Safe Key₤ 50 - ₤ 200Step 5: Installation and Testing
As soon as you have actually received your new key, make sure that it works correctly throughout all intended uses. If it’s a smart key, require time to program it with your vehicle.
Preventative Measures and Key Management
To prevent the trouble of lost keys in the future, executing some preventive measures is advisable.
Key Management TipsDesignate a key area: Always keep type in a designated spot in the house or work.Use a keychain: Attach all keys to a keychain with your contact info.Extra Keys: Consider offering an extra key to a trusted buddy or family member.Tracking Devices: Invest in Bluetooth tracking gadgets that can assist locate keys.Smart Lock Systems: Upgrade to smart locks that use digital codes or mobile phones, getting rid of the requirement for physical keys.Advantages of a Proactive ApproachTime-saving: Less time is invested looking for keys.Stress Reduction: Knowing there’s a plan in place relieves anxiety about losing keys.Affordable: With proper management, one can substantially reduce replacement expenses.FAQs About Lost Key Replacement
Q1: What ought to I do if I lose my car key while on the road?A: If you lose your
car key, think about getting in touch with roadside support services. If you have a spare key, that might be an option too. If not, getting in touch with a locksmith or your dealership is the finest strategy. Q2: Can I replace a lost key myself?A: While you can try to create
a brand-new key based upon existing ones or lock impressions, it is suggested to speak with an expert locksmith to ensure security. Q3: Are lost keys covered by insurance?A: Generally, property owners or tenants insurance coverage might cover lost keys, however it’s suggested to examine with your insurance coverage service provider for specific details
.Q4: How long does it take to replace a lost key?A: Replacement time varies: house keys can take minutes, while specialized car keys might require a day or more to program. Q5: Is it smart to alter locks after losing house keys?A:
Changing the locks is a sensible step if you are concerned about security, especially if keys were lost in a public location.
